Description
1 By Juliana, widow of John Jolyf, called le Plomer, of Bath
2 John Batyn, of Bath
From 1 to 2
A rent of 7s. which she received from Adam Dodyng, and Juliana, his wife, for a tenement, etc, which they hold of her for their lives, which is situate in Brade Street, between the tenement of John Rolves, the elder, on the north, and the tenement belonging to the Commonalty which Thomas Sulye holds, on the south; and grant that the said tenement after their death ought to revert to her for ever by reason of the legacy of the said John, late her husband, shall remain to the said John Batyn and his heirs. To hold the said rent of 7s. together with the reversion of the said tenement to the said John Batyn and his heirs. Rendering therefor yearly to the Proctors of the Commonalty of Bath 12d.
Witnesses: Roger Crist, Mayor; Adam Whytesone; William Swayn; Henry Hurel; Richard de Vygnour; William Cubbul; Peter de Lewes.
Dated at Bath, 28 of December, 14 Edw. III.
